Hi everyone, I've been searching the net all day and reading about this before I posted but here goes, I've got a 300tdi edc auto and its using fuel like its going out of fashion it's done half a tank and not even done 100 miles on that. I've changed air and fuel filter checked for leaks and found nothing. Going to check for leaks on intake manifold and boost pipes. Just wondered if anydody else has same problem or can point me in the right direction as its costing me a fortune
 
How are you driving it? I'm sure I could make mine do 100 miles on half a tank if I drove it hard enough.

If that's not the problem, I've read on here that the lift pump can leak fuel into the block so it might be worth checking your engine oil level to see if that's where your fuel is going.

remaps are not easy on a 300 as the chip needs to be unsoldered and a new one soldered in & most places don't do that anymore, they just like plugging a computer in downloading a new image and sending you off.
